1. What are the factors to consider while choosing a franchise to invest in?
When selecting a franchise, it is crucial to consider various factors to ensure a profitable venture. One of the essential aspects to evaluate is the brand recognition and reputation of the franchise. Investing in a well-established and reputable brand can help attract customers and instill confidence in the business. It is also important to assess the demand for the products or services offered by the franchise in the specific location or market segment you plan to operate in. Other factors to consider include the initial investment costs, ongoing fees, support provided by the franchisor, and the potential for growth and profitability.

2. How can I determine if a franchise is financially viable?
Evaluating the financial viability of a franchise is essential to ensure a successful investment. Conducting thorough due diligence by reviewing the franchise’s financial information, including the franchise disclosure document (FDD), is crucial. The FDD provides important details about the franchise’s financial performance, such as historical sales figures, estimated startup costs, and ongoing expenses. This information can help potential franchisees assess the profitability and return on investment of the franchise opportunity. Additionally, consulting with a financial advisor or a franchise consultant with experience in the industry can provide valuable insights into the financial viability of the franchise.

3. How can I choose a franchise that aligns with my interests and skills?
Selecting a franchise that aligns with your interests and skills is vital for long-term satisfaction and success as a franchise owner. Consider your passion and expertise when exploring different franchise opportunities. Evaluate your skills and strengths, and identify franchises that complement your background. For instance, if you have a background in marketing, a franchise in the advertising or digital marketing industry might be an excellent fit. Additionally, researching the day-to-day operations, responsibilities, and requirements of various franchises can help determine if they align with your personal and professional goals.

4. What are some of the most profitable franchise sectors in the US?
While profitability may vary depending on various factors, some franchise sectors tend to be more lucrative than others. Fast food restaurants, such as McDonald’s and Subway, have long been known for their profitability due to their strong brand recognition and consistent consumer demand. The health and wellness industry, including fitness centers, gyms, and spas, has also seen significant growth and profitability in recent years. Another thriving sector is home services, including residential cleaning, lawn care, and pest control, as homeowners increasingly seek professional assistance in maintaining their homes. It is important to research and analyze the market trends in different sectors to identify the most profitable franchise opportunities at any given time.
